headlight frames early to late 200

You should keep the old headlights and just get the frames and grille from an '81-'85 240. The '86-'93 240 that used the large plastic headlights also have different fenders, hood, grille, turn signals, and radiator support. Those plastic headlights also don't give the quality of light that you can get from the 4 rectangular headlights.

You could replace your headlights with e-code glass lights that are similar in size to the '86-'93 headlights, but these are very rare, and when you do find them, they are expensive. They are a direct swap for the 4 rect. lights, so you wouldn't need to swap a bunch of parts.
